Cost Strategies for Maximizing Revenue
Achieving optimal revenue necessitates implementing strategic pricing strategies that strike a balance between profitability and market competitiveness. A dynamic approach involves analyzing consumer demand, competitor pricing, and production costs to determine the ideal price point for your products or services. Investigate various pricing models such as value-based pricing, where prices are set according to the perceived value delivered, or cost-plus pricing, which adds a fixed markup to the production cost. Regularly assess market trends and check here customer feedback to refine your pricing strategy and ensure continued revenue expansion.
- Implement data-driven analysis to determine the most profitable pricing model.
- Present tiered pricing options to address different customer segments and their varying demands.
- Utilize promotional pricing strategies, such as discounts or bundles, to boost sales during slow seasons.
Bear in mind that pricing is not a static element. Periodically assess your strategy and make adjustments as needed to maximize revenue potential.

Inventory Control: Balancing Supply and Demand
Optimizing inventory is a vital aspect of each productive business. It involves precisely regulating the flow of goods to meet consumer requirements. Efficient inventory control ensures that businesses have the appropriate quantity of products on hand to meet customer orders without incurring unnecessary storage costs or experiencing stockouts. Implementing sound inventory control practices can substantially boost a company's operational performance by lowering costs, maximizing customer satisfaction, and expediting the overall logistics.
